Discussion and possible action on the 2015-16 Strategic Action Plan Items:
ITEM SUMMARY:
· Goal 1: Attracting & Retaining a Healthy Business Mix
a) Acknowledge contributions made by downtown businesses promoting Georgetown
· Present Main Street Star Awards, as needed, at quarterly Breakfast Bites or Downtown Low
Down meetings – Trisha
· Goal 2: Raising Awareness and Funding for Main Street Program Projects
o Discuss importance of how projects are presented to the public - Cindy
a) Increase awareness of Small Business Saturday and funding for Main Street projects through
annual Ladies Nite Out “Paint the Town Red” to raise $5,000 – Kay/Becca
· Review top quotes for graphic designer for LNO – Cindy/Vicki
· Review top quotes on Swag Bags and present to committee – Shelly/Becca
· Set deadlines and update progress - Kay/Becca
· Theme “Paint the Town Red”, graphics and décor to include “Save the Date” cards, ads, posters,
Facebook headers, coupon book, signage and map – Shelly/Kay/Becca
· Determine sponsorship levels and recruit sponsors – Vicki/Becca
· Select volunteer coordinator (need about 12 volunteers) – need volunteer lead
· Recruit downtown host businesses and other Georgetown retail partners (shopping, services and
attractions) – Kay/Becca/Vicki/Cindy
· Organize and plan Man Cave – Blake/Nelson
· Live music and confirm photographer – Ken/Shelly
· Coordinate and discuss Fashion Show – Kay/Alva/Zelinda
· Solicit and prepare coupon book – Trisha/ Denise/Kathy/Liz
· Solicit giveaways for swag bags – need volunteer lead
· Coordinate advertising, publicity – Shelly/Kay/Becca
· Promote and secure freebies for Small Business Saturday promotion - Shelly
· Evaluate event and celebrate success – Cindy/Kay/Becca
b) Increase funding for the Façade & Sign Grant Program and Main Street projects through the
annual Georgetown Swirl to raise $20,000
· Select Swirl Co-Chair – Vicki
· Discuss professional fundraiser and sponsorship levels – Vicki/Cindy
· Discuss event locations – Vicki/Cindy/Shelly
· Determine participating Texas wineries - Shelly
· Determine participating local restaurants – Cindy
· Determine participating retailers – Trisha
· VIP Coordinators – Trisha/Cindy
· Décor and Rentals as needed – Kathy
· Select volunteer coordinator – need volunteer lead
· Secure entertainment and photographer (Todd White?) - Shelly
· Coordinate graphics, signage, advertising, publicity – Shelly
· Evaluate event and celebrate success – Vicki/Cindy
